The purpose of the New Kent County Special Education Advisory Committee is to advise and assist the New Kent County School Division in identifying strengths and weaknesses of its special education services.  The SEAC members are appointed by the local school board and is comprised of parents of students with disabilities who attend New Kent County Schools.

The SEAC meetings include presentations on relevant special education topics and a public comment period.  If you are interested in providing comments and are unable to attend the meetings, you may provide written comments by submitting them to one of the committee members.
